Ticket #4471 — Config drift: report export timezones

Heads up for whoever's on call: the Ledgerette export service in staging is stamping reports in local server time again, while prod correctly uses the configured zone. Looks like someone hand-edited staging after the Averholm migration and never committed it. Finance noticed their daily exports are off by five hours. Please reconcile staging back to what's in source control. For reference, prod is currently running these values.

config for kafof-bawef:
holath:
  log_level: debug
  metrics_host: metrics.holath.qorvelsys.internal
  pin: 2191
  pool_size: 32

# Break-Glass: Catalog Cache Invalidation

Scope: the Pinrow product catalog at Veldstone Retail. If stale prices persist after a purge and the Hollowmere invalidation queue is wedged, use break-glass to flush the edge tier directly. Contractors: get verbal sign-off from the catalog lead first. Steps: open the Hollowmere admin shell, select emergency-flush, confirm the tenant, and run it once — repeated flushes thrash the origin. Access is logged and expires after 20 minutes. Unseal the admin shell with the passphrase below.

recovery phrase for kahop-tajog: istix-casvan

Ticket: StockMender nightly reconciliation job keeps double-counting returns from the Fenwick warehouse feed. Looks like the dedupe window is too narrow when the feed arrives late. New folks: this job is idempotent, so re-running it is safe. Workaround for now is rerunning with a 48h window. To reproduce, use the build identified by the token below.

pipeline stamp: htk31_f769b577b3028a4e9958e5bb8d1259a